使用 jQuery 获取 HTML 文档的 Title 标签

在网页开发中,<title> 标签是一个非常重要的元素,它用于定义网页的标题。在浏览器的标签页中,用户通过这个标题来识别和切换不同的页面。本文将介绍如何使用 jQuery 获取网页的 title 标签,并结合一些示例代码进行说明。

什么是 jQuery?

jQuery 是一个快速、小巧且功能丰富的 JavaScript 库。它简化了 HTML 文档遍历、事件处理、动画效果以及 Ajax 交互等操作。由于其强大的简便性,jQuery 在网页开发中得到了广泛的应用。

如何获取 Title 标签

获取网页的 title 标签是一个简单的 jQuery 操作。可以通过 document.title 或者 jQuery 的选择器来访问。以下是两种常见的方法:

方法 1:使用 document.title

$(document).ready(function() {
    var title = document.title; // 获取 title
    console.log("当前网页的标题是:" + title);
});

在这个代码示例中,我们使用了 jQuery 的 $(document).ready() 方法,它确保 DOM 元素在 JavaScript 运行之前已经加载完成。然后,我们通过 document.title 获取网页的标题,并将其输出到控制台。

方法 2:使用 jQuery 选择器

$(document).ready(function() {
    var title = $("title").text(); // 通过选择器获取 title
    console.log("当前网页的标题是:" + title);
});

在这个例子中,我们使用 jQuery 选择器 $("title") 来获取 <title> 标签的文本内容。这种方法相对简单直观,同样能够得到网页的标题信息。

状态图

在网页开发中,适时获取和修改 title 标签的状态是非常重要的,因为它能够为用户提供更好的体验。下面是一个状态图,展示了获取和更新 title 标签的不同状态。

stateDiagram
    [*] --> 获取标题
    获取标题 --> 标题有效
    获取标题 --> 标题无效
    标题有效 --> 更新标题
    标题无效 --> [*]
    更新标题 --> [*]

饼状图

为了更好地理解网页标题在用户体验的重要性,我们可以使用饼状图来展示用户对标题的关注度。这可以帮助开发者更好地优化网页设计。

pie
    title 用户对网页标题关注度
    "关注网页标题" : 70
    "忽略网页标题" : 30

结尾

获取网页的 title 标签是前端开发中一项基本而又重要的技能。无论是通过 document.title 还是 jQuery 选择器,我们都可以轻松获取和Manipulate标题内容。掌握这项技能后,开发者可以进一步提升用户体验,确保网站在用户心中留下深刻的印象。希望本文对你在 jQuery 操作中的应用有所帮助!